About us

OBH-Rutland Nursing Home located on the campus of Kingsbrook Jewish Medical Center, is a skilled nursing facility member of One Brooklyn Health System family of Hospitals, nursing homes and assisted living facilities. The facility offers short-term rehabilitation, sub-acute care, long-term care, comprehensive wound care and specialty units for ventilator dependent residents. Rutland also has dedicated Pediatric and Young Adult long-term care units.

We're looking for a Pediatric Nurse Practitioner with strong committment to patient care. The Nurse Practitioner (NP) is a mid-level health care provider, who works collaboratively within a multi-disciplinary health team and is responsible for providing direct comprehensive care to patients and supervision of ancillary staff. The NP educates the patient, family/significant other by promoting wellness, preventing health care problems, maintaining current health status, and intervening in acute or chronic illness.
